Play Synopsis
The play, intricately weaves together the forgotten tale of Khan Bahadur Qazi Azizul Haque with the vibrant hues of colonial India. Through a blend of poignant storytelling, dynamic scenography, and live music, the audience is transported to a bygone era, where the genius of Haque emerges from obscurity. From his formative years enamored with mathematics to his pivotal role in crafting the Henry Classification System alongside Hem Chandra Bose under Edward Henry’s Bengal Police, the narrative unfolds with rich historical detail.
Interwoven with Haque’s journey are snapshots of the national movement and the enigmatic Thuggees of Calcutta, adding layers of complexity to the storyline. The central character, a Thuggee facing execution, serves as the narrator, guiding the audience through the tapestry of events. Each thread represents a significant historical moment or character, skillfully intertwined to form a captivating narrative.
The play’s immersive experience is heightened by the evocative live music and the versatile performances of the ensemble cast, many of whom portray multiple roles. It offers a vivid portrayal of a forgotten hero and a compelling exploration of India’s colonial past.
